MADISON OP ART SATEEN ABIGAIL SHOULDER BAG
http://forum.purseblog.com/coach/reveal-bordeaux-abigail-abby-gail-709503.html
This bag is the perfect size...not small, not medium, not large...it's just right. Its so comfortable on the shoulder or carrying on arm. The strap drop makes it easy to access stuff without putting bag down. Holds alot and still lightweight. Has ziptop closure. This is a great everyday bag.
Handles with 8-3/4" drop
11-3/4" (L) x 12-1/4" (H) x 5" (W)
picture.php




MADISON OP ART SATEEN LARGE SOPHIA SATCHEL
This bag is large and holds everything and more. It has extra shoulder strap if needed but the rolled straps fit just fine on the shoulders. It has a wide zipper opening.
Handle with 6" drop
24" detachable shoulder strap with 12" drop
Approx Dimensions: 17"L x 12"H x 3.25"D

I would think that the Abigail makes the best shoulder bag of those. Like others have said, the Maggie has too many compartments, so there isn't as much room. The large Sophia fits on your shoulder but isn't really a shoulder bag. The MSB would be great but isn't made anymore. The Lindsey is a big bag too.
Have you considered the large Kristen hobo? It is the most comfortable shoulder bag they make. 16 1/2" (L ) x 14" (H) x 4 1/4" (W)
